Case History 2/8/2024

Tinaba

La progettazione di una nuova architettura a microservizi e la progressiva migrazione dei servizi erogati dal back-end ha permesso un importante miglioramento delle performance, della scalabilità, della robustezza e della sicurezza della piattaforma Tinaba.

application modernization

Tinaba - «this is not a bank» è il servizio innovativo di pagamento e investimento mobile proposto da Banca Profilo per facilitare i pagamenti e i trasferimenti di denaro

Tinaba aveva l’esigenza di rendere più flessibile l’architettura della propria piattaforma di back-end, che gestisce l’erogazione di tutti i servizi erogati verso i consumatori finali e verso gli esercizi commerciali che utilizzano Tinaba, al fine di rendere più facile e veloce innovare i servizi erogati in un contesto di mercato altamente dinamico. 

Il progetto realizzato da WebScience ha comportato la progettazione di una nuova architettura a microservizi e la progressiva migrazione dei servizi erogati dal back-end pre-esistente verso la nuova architettura, garantendo la convivenza dei due ambienti durante un periodo transitorio della durata di un anno. La completa riscrittura del software di back-end ha permesso inoltre un importante miglioramento delle performance, della scalabilità, della robustezza e della sicurezza della piattaforma Tinaba.  

Grazie all’approccio a microservizi e alla roadmap di migrazione graduale, è stato possibile introdurre nuovi servizi destinati agli utenti finali anche nel corso del progetto, realizzandoli direttamente sulla nuova architettura.  

La gestione Agile del progetto ha offerto a Tinaba la flessibilità necessaria per seguire le mutevoli priorità di business e l’adozione di pratiche e strumenti di DevOps ha permesso di rilasciare velocemente e con elevata confidenza i servizi di back-end man mano che questi venivano realizzati.